Ganso Yoshinoya Shiratama Manju

A famous confection founded in 1882, originating from the legend of Princess Yodo of Kawakami Gorge. These are additive-free white steamed buns made using home-milled non-glutinous rice and Hokkaido adzuki beans, finished through a process of double-kneading and double-steaming. It is a fleeting taste with a shelf life of only two days.
